Note-UtleyHe Mr. Allen E. Williams, 86, died on Friday, November 14 at theTennessee State Veterans Home in Humboldt. Funeral services wereconducted on Sunday, November 16 at 2:00 p.m. in the DildayFuneral Home Chapel with Rev. Fred Ward officiating. Intermentfollowed in the Hickory Flatt Cemetery near Cedar Grove. Mr.Williams, the son of the late Clark and Gracie Burke Williamswas born October 18, 1917 in Dyer. At the age of 10, he moved toHuntingdon with his family. On May 23, 1942 he was drafted intothe United States Army. He served three and one half year in theAsiatic-Pacific Theater in World War II. In 1946, he was electedCircuit Court Clerk for Carroll County and served one term. Hissecond military career began on November 12, 1949 with theTennessee Army National Guard when he entered on the date ofFederal Recognition of Anti Tank Company, 117th Infantry. OnDecember 15, 1948, he accepted the full-time position of UnitAdministrator of the Huntingdon unit. He served in this capacityuntil his retirement in 1977, after 33 years and four months ofservice to his country. His awards include: Asiatic-PacificTheater medal, with one bronze star, Good Conduct medal,National Defense service medal; World War II Victory medal,Armed Forces Reserve medal; National Guard Distinguished ServiceMedal, Tennessee National Guard Commendation Medal and numerousother state awards. In 1974 he received the first “Chief’sFifty” recruiting award which was presented personally by theChief, National Guard Bureau, in Washington, D.C. On August 8,1993, the Huntingdon National Guard was dedicated and renamedthe Allen E. Williams Armory. Survivors include his wife of 67years, Mrs. Lois Cook Williams; one son, Steve Williams and onebrother Johnny Williams, all of Huntingdon. Two brothers, BillyWilliams and Dallas Williams preceded him in death.1

Note-UtleyHe Frank Rainey (also listed as Paul Franklin Rainey), along with abusiness partner named Bond, established Rainey Bond Furniturein Jackson, Tennessee. Sometime later, the partner was boughtout and the business was owned solely by Frank Rainey and itbecame, quite literally, a family owned and operated business.Further, it was very successful and became well respected over avery wide geographical area because of the fair dealings withcustomers regardless of race or income. Previously, Frank hadbeen a farmer and an insurance salesman.
